Engineering Staff Augmentation Cost in 2026: What a US SaaS Team Should Budget

Key takeaways

  • Use $50 to $199 per hour as a starting band for 2026 staff augmentation budgeting.
  • The real budget number is the vendor rate multiplied by the hours and term you plan to buy.
  • BLS puts median US software developer pay at $133,080.
  • BLS pay and employer compensation data imply a rough employer cost near $190,000 a year for a median US software developer.
  • The right comparison is contract run rate versus employer cost, not hourly rate versus salary.

Budget staff augmentation with an hourly planning band of $50 to $199. Then turn that rate into a contract cost using your expected hours, and compare the run rate with a rough direct-hire benchmark of about $190,000 a year for a median US software developer based on BLS pay and employer compensation data.

Use a rate band, not a single average

Start with $50 to $199 per hour. Clutch lists that as a common staff augmentation pricing range, which makes it a workable first-pass budget for a US SaaS team.

A single number hides too much. The published range is wide, so the useful question is not "what is the average rate?" It is "how many hours do we plan to buy, and for how long?"

Convert the hourly rate into your contract cost

Your vendor cost is the hourly rate multiplied by the hours in your contract. That math is more useful than comparing a rate card with a salary line.

Use this sequence:

  • Hourly rate x planned hours = contract cost for that period
  • Contract cost across the full term = run rate

This keeps a part-time specialist, one full-time engineer, and a fixed-term engagement in the same budgeting framework.

Compare the run rate with a US direct hire

A median US software developer salary is $133,080, according to the Bureau of Labor Statistics. The BLS employer compensation release shows private-industry compensation averaging $46.60 per hour, with $14.01 of that in benefits.

Using that wage-to-compensation ratio as a rough loading factor, a salary at the BLS median lands near $190,000 a year in employer cost. It is a planning benchmark, not a quote.

That comparison is why rate alone misleads. A vendor rate can look high hourly and still fit a defined contract. A vendor rate can also look moderate and still outrun a direct hire if the contract runs long enough.

What a US SaaS team should actually do

Budget against scope first. Then test that scope against both the vendor run rate and the direct-hire benchmark.

Use a simple checklist:

  • Define the role in delivery terms
  • Set the expected hours
  • Price the full contract term
  • Compare that total with the direct-hire benchmark

This is the cleanest way to decide whether dedicated engineers fit the backlog you need to move now.
